Torsång
Torsång is a locality situated in Borlänge Municipality, Dalarna County, Sweden with 666 inhabitants in 2010.
It is situated on lakes Runnsjön and Osjön and the river Dalälven, which are connected with the canal Lillälven.
Torsång Court District, or Torsångs tingslag, was a district of Dalarna in Sweden. The court district served as the basic division of the rural areas in Dalarna, except for one district that was a hundred. The entire province had once been a single hundred, called Dala hundare.
